在日常的编程工作中,我们可能会遇到需要在TB(例如:Tableau Bridge 或 Think-cell Bridge)中调用用户自定义函数的需求。本文将详细介绍如何在TB中实现这一功能,并提供一些实用的技巧。 首先,我们需要明确用户函数的定义。用户函数是一段由用户自行编写的、可重复使用的代码块,它可以接受参数并返回结果。在TB中调用用户函数能够大大提高我们的工作效率,减少重复劳动。 以下是调用用户函数的具体步骤:
- 定义函数:根据具体的编程语言和TB环境,首先需要定义你的用户函数。例如,在Tableau中,你可以使用计算字段来定义函数;而在Think-cell中,则可能需要通过VBA来实现。
- 导入函数:确保你的用户函数已经被正确导入到TB中。这可能涉及到将函数文件放置在正确的目录下,或者在TB的设置中指定函数所在的路径。
- 调用函数:在TB的相应位置,通过特定的语法来调用你的用户函数。这通常需要使用到调用语句,例如在Tableau中可能是:[函数名(参数)];在Think-cell中可能是:CallFunction(函数名, 参数)。
- 传递参数:根据函数定义,传递正确的参数。参数可以是常数、字段引用或其他的函数返回值。
- 使用结果:用户函数执行后,其返回的结果可以用于TB中的各种计算或展示。 在完成以上步骤后,你就可以在TB中顺利地调用用户函数了。需要注意的是,为了保证函数的稳定性和性能,应当进行充分的测试。 最后,总结一下在TB中调用用户函数的关键要点:定义清晰、导入正确、调用准确、参数匹配以及充分测试。遵循这些原则,可以帮助我们在TB中高效地利用用户函数,提升数据处理和分析的效率。